Grown over 4 hectares of clay and limestone soils in the upper Loire. Grapes are hand-picked, direct pressed and ferment in stainless steel for 2 years. This is the only cuvee from Sebastien that has the smallest amount of SO2 added a bottling, less than 10mg/l.
Sébastien Riffault produces a kind of Sancerre that bears little resemblance to the wines most produce in that appellation today. He often harvests with a large percentage of botrytis and is not afraid of oxygen or time on skins. The resulting wines are complex, nigh kaleidoscopic expressions of Sauvignon Blanc and Pinot Noir that really resonate.
